Traveling to Machu Picchu on a budget is an unforgettable experience that doesn't have to break the bank. One of the most affordable routes is to take the Inca Trail, which is not only a trek but a cultural journey through the Andes. However, if you're looking for a cheaper alternative, consider the Hydroelectric route.
This route involves taking a bus or train to Hydroelectric Station, followed by a scenic hike along the train tracks to Aguas Calientes. The hike takes approximately 2-3 hours and offers bre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ains and lush landscapes.
Once you reach Aguas Calientes, be sure to explore the town's hot springs, which are a perfect way to relax after your trek. For accommodation, many hostels and budget hotels are available, allowing you to save money while enjoying local hospitality.
When planning your visit, consider purchasing your tickets to Machu Picchu in advance, as prices can vary and sell out quickly. Guided tours are also available at reasonable rates, providing valuable insights into the history and significance of the site.
While in Aguas Calientes, indulge in local Peruvian cuisine at affordable eateries, where you can try dishes like ceviche or lomo saltado.
On the day of your visit to Machu Picchu, take the early bus to avoid the crowds and enjoy the sunrise over the ancient ruins. Don't forget to bring your camera, as the views are truly stunning!
As you explore, keep an eye out for the diverse flora and fauna that call this UNESCO World Heritage site home. Remember to stay hydrated and wear sunscreen, as the altitude can be intense.
Finally, engage with local guides who can share fascinating stories and cultural insights, enriching your experience. Traveling to Machu Picchu on a budget is not only feasible but also a chance to immerse yourself in the rich culture and natural beauty of Peru.
